Accurate passing is commonly evaluated through various performance indicators. One important performance indicator includes pass accuracy percentage, which indicates the consistency of a player's distribution. Despite the fact that high passing percentages are valuable, they need to be analyzed within the context of the match. During competitive matches, a defensive midfielder may complete controlled ball movement, while an offensive player often tries creative through balls. Even if the creative midfielder has reduced completion rates, his or her attacking passes often produce dangerous attacks. Therefore, football managers integrate statistical analysis to build a more accurate evaluation of player performance. This balanced approach supports both individual development and team success.
